If you skip the base and put up the shed on the flat ground then for
starters it'll rot. Then it'll shift.


Whenever I have done sheds I have always used concrete blocks and load
bearing timbers. Concrete blocks spaced about 2' apart and load bearers
on top of that. Bit of polythene betwen the concrete and the timber and
bo sherunkle.

The main advantage is that air is allowed to circulate under the floor
and stop the formation of rot/mould.

There's a shed at my mums that was done this way and it's been stood
for 45+ years. She bought it scondhand and it was apparently a good 20
years old then..
